I find following your own analysis on candlesticks in the FX platform is a lot more reliable than any index. Reading index reports does provide an overall direction of a pair but studying candlestick momentum during intraday trading is far more reliable than daily reports. Forex traders can make healthy profits on 25pips (.25%) in either direction.
Therefore, candlestick analysis during your day allows you to capture a substantial profit irrespective of the pairs’ overall trend.
